Home window replacement services involve removing existing windows and installing new, modern units to enhance the appearance and functionality of a property. This process typically includes evaluating the current window conditions, selecting appropriate replacement options, and ensuring proper installation for optimal performance. The service aims to improve the overall aesthetic of a building while also addressing issues related to energy efficiency and security. Professionals in this field focus on delivering a seamless replacement experience that aligns with the specific needs of each property.

One of the primary reasons property owners seek window replacement services is to resolve problems associated with aging or damaged windows. Common issues include drafts, difficulty opening or closing, condensation buildup, and visible deterioration such as rotting frames or cracked glass. Replacing faulty windows can help reduce energy costs by improving insulation, prevent water intrusion that could lead to structural damage, and enhance security by upgrading to more robust locking mechanisms. These improvements contribute to a more comfortable and secure living or working environment.

The overview below groups typical Home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Austin,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Average Cost Range - Home window replacement services typically range from $300 to $800 per window, depending on size and material. For example, standard double-pane windows in Austin, TX, might fall within this range. Costs can vary based on the window type and installation complexity.

Factors Influencing Cost - The overall expense depends on window size, frame material, and whether the project includes additional features like energy efficiency upgrades. Larger or custom-shaped windows tend to cost more, often exceeding $1,000 per unit in some cases.

Installation Fees - Professional installation fees generally range from $150 to $300 per window. These costs cover labor, removal of old windows, and proper sealing to ensure optimal performance, with prices varying by local contractor rates.

Additional Expenses - Costs for permits, disposal of old windows, and potential repairs can add to the total project. It's common for total expenses to range from $1,200 to $3,000 for a full home replacement, depending on the number of windows and specific requ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Homeowners in Austin, TX often seek window replacement services when their existing windows become damaged, drafty, or inefficient. Over time, exposure to the Texas sun and weather can lead to warping, cracking, or fogging, prompting property owners to consider new windows that enhance energy efficiency and curb appeal. Additionally, replacing outdated or broken windows can improve indoor comfort and reduce energy bills, making it a practical upgrade for many local residents.
